The Stock Market

A tried and tested investment obviously comes in the form of stocks. Rising and falling markets are common in this type of investment, which can deter people from pursuing what they may often consider to be a ‘high risk’ investment scheme. However, this is not necessarily the case, especially if you know what trading mistakes to avoid.

The return on investment from stocks is why it is such an appealing investment stream. That and the fact that you can use online brokers in the modern world to trade stocks, no need to run down to your nearest Stock Exchange for the privilege. Choose a broker with low rates, especially if you plan to trade infrequently – which you should in order to maintain profit – and ensure the platform is user-friendly. You want to understand the trades you are making completely so a confusing platform would be counter-intuitive to this.

If you’re really unsure about stocks, then it is possible to practice at stocks first. Some brokers offer a trading platform which is based on the real market, but doesn’t actually involve trading real money. It’s very much like a ‘game’. But, it can offer you the chance to gain real experience when it comes to stock trading, invaluable if you’re unsure or nervous about trying to enter this money stream. Paying Debts

A good investment, no matter the economic climate, is to put some money aside to pay off your personal debts. Being debt-free opens up the possibilities for other investments and also gives you more financial freedom. It’s not as glamorous as the stock market or property, but if you’re in a position to make investments, then you should think about using that spare capital to pay debts.

Wealth is not only determined by your assets, but also by your liabilities. Debt is a liability which can affect your overall wealth, so keep it in check as much as possible!

Starting a Business

Investing in yourself and advancing your career is perhaps one of the best investments you can make. Full stop. Which can mean putting money aside to start your own side hustle or full-blown business. Some side hustles require barely any initial investment and can give you some great business experience. For example, you could sell products on a platform; learning how to market things, how to handle customers, and how to organize a payment and delivery schedule.

The long-term value of being in charge of your own money stream is undeniable. Considering the political and economic uncertainty at the moment, having a second income to support you during what could be difficult times is obviously a big bonus. And it doesn’t have to be a substantial stream of money, after all, it all depends on the amount of time/resources you have to invest in the project.

And don’t forget that any money you earn from a side hustle – after-tax – can then be fed into your other investment opportunities, such as stocks or property. It can become a cycle of good financial planning.
